I put a mini carrot with the greens on top (from the organic market) in one of those test-tube type waterers, upside down so the greens stay fresh all day, and place a perch where they can eat the tops. They nibble them clean every time! Also works for piece of lettuce or kale, with the bottom thinned so that it fits into the glass thing, and these birds seem to love greens more than any of my other birds! Anyway, I am enjoying them.
